DBL CEPHALOTIN SODIUM 1g powder for injection vial Australija - engleski - Department of Health (Therapeutic Goods Administration)

dbl cephalotin sodium 1g powder for injection vial

juno pharmaceuticals pty ltd - cefalotin sodium, quantity: 1.058 g (equivalent: cefalotin, qty 1 g) - injection, powder for - excipient ingredients: sodium bicarbonate - indications: cephalothin sodium for injection is indicated for the treatment of serious infections caused by susceptible strains of the designated microorganisms in the diseases listed below. culture and susceptibility studies should be performed. however, therapy may be instituted before results of susceptibility studies are obtained (see pharmacology: microbiology). respiratory tract: infections caused by s. pneumoniae, staphylococci (penicillinase and nonpenicillinase producing), group a beta-haemolytic streptococci, klebsiella, and h. influenzae. skin and soft tissue: infections, including peritonitis, caused by staphylococci (penicillinase and nonpenicillinase producing), group a beta-haemolytic streptococci, e.coli, pr. mirabilis and klebsiella. genitourinary tract: infections caused by e. coli, pr. mirabilis and klebsiella. septicaemia, including endocarditis: infections caused by s. pneumoniae, staphylococci (penicillinase and nonpenicillinase producing), group a beta-haemolytic streptococci, s.

ZETAF 1g ceftazidime (as pentahydrate) 1g powder for injection vial Australija - engleski - Department of Health (Therapeutic Goods Administration)

zetaf 1g ceftazidime (as pentahydrate) 1g powder for injection vial

strides pharma science pty ltd - ceftazidime pentahydrate, quantity: 1175 mg (equivalent: ceftazidime, qty 1000 mg) - injection, powder for - excipient ingredients: sodium carbonate - ceftazidime for injection is indicated for the treatment of single and mixed infections caused by susceptible aerobic organisms with suspected or documented resistance to other antimicrobials, but not to ceftazidime, and as an alternative to aminoglycosides in pseudomonal infection in patients in whom aminoglycoside toxicity is a cause for concern and other pseudomonal antibiotics cannot be used. ,indications include the following:,severe infections in general: ,for example: septicaemia including neonatal sepsis, bacteraemia; and in patients in intensive care units with specific problems, e.g., infected burns.,respiratory tract infections: ,for example: pneumonia, broncho-pneumonia, infected pleurisy, infected bronchiectasis and bronchitis.,severe ear, nose and throat infections: ,for example: otitis media, mastoiditis.,urinary tract infections: ,for example: acute and chronic pyelonephritis, pyelitis, cystitis, urethritis (bacterial only), and infections associated with bladder and renal stones.,skin and soft tissue infections: ,for example, erysipelas, abscesses, cellulitis, infected burns and wounds, mastitis.,gastrointestinal and abdominal infections: ,for example: intra-abdominal abscesses, enterocolitis.,bone and joint infections: ,for example: osteitis, osteomyelitis, septic arthritis, infected bursitis.

COLISTIN LINK colistimethate sodium (equivalent to colistin 150 mg, 4,500,000 IU)  powder for injection vial Australija - engleski - Department of Health (Therapeutic Goods Administration)

colistin link colistimethate sodium (equivalent to colistin 150 mg, 4,500,000 iu) powder for injection vial

link medical products pty ltd t/a link pharmaceuticals - colistimethate sodium (equivalent: colistin, qty iu) - injection, powder for - excipient ingredients: - colistin link parental is indicated for the treatment of acute or chronic infections due to sensitive strains of certain gram-negative bacilli. it is particularly indicated when the infection is caused by sensitve strains of pseudomonas aeruginosa. this antibiotic is not indicated for infections due to proteus and neisseria. colistin link parental has proven clinically effective in treatment of infections due to the following gram-negative organisms: enterobacter aerogenes, escherichia coli, klebsiella pneumoniae and pseudomonas aeruginosa. pending results of appropriate bacterialogic cultures and sensitvity tests, colistin link parental may be used to initiate therapy in serious infections that are suspected due to gram-negative organisms.
